Encyclopedia Entry: 74FCT162244ETPAG8

Product Overview

  • Category: Integrated Circuit (IC)
  • Use: Signal Buffer/Line Driver
  • Characteristics: High-speed, low-power, non-inverting, 16-bit buffer/driver
  • Package: TSSOP-48
  • Essence: The 74FCT162244ETPAG8 is a high-performance buffer/driver IC designed to provide signal buffering and line driving capabilities for various digital systems.
  • Packaging/Quantity: Available in tape and reel packaging with 2500 units per reel.

Specifications

  • Logic Family: FCT
  • Number of Bits: 16
  • Input/Output Type: Non-Inverting
  • Supply Voltage Range: 4.5V to 5.5V
  • Operating Temperature Range: -40°C to +85°C
  • Propagation Delay: 3.5ns (typical)
  • Output Drive Strength: ±24mA
  • ESD Protection: >2000V (Human Body Model)
